[发明专利]一种铁路防护网入侵警报系统及其工作方法有效
申请号: | 202110155550.0 | 申请日: | 2021-02-04 |
公开(公告)号: | CN112863094B | 公开(公告)日: | 2022-10-21 |
发明(设计)人: | 刘展汝;刘洋 | 申请(专利权)人: | 西南交通大学;中科(湖南)先进轨道交通研究院有限公司 |
主分类号: | G08B13/12 | 分类号: | G08B13/12;G08B13/16;G08B25/10 |
代理公司: | 武汉臻诚专利代理事务所(普通合伙) 42233 | 代理人: | 宋业斌 |
地址: | 610031 四*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 铁路 防护 入侵 警报 系统 及其 工作 方法 | ||
1.一种铁路防护网入侵警报系统的工作方法,所述铁路防护网入侵警报系统包括发送端和接收端,其中发送端包括MCU模块、扫频信号发生器模块、超声波驱动模块、第一Lora模块、以及第一超声波换能器,接收端包括数字信号处理模块、通讯模块、第二Lora模块、存储模块、超声波信号调节模块、第二超声波换能器、以及模数转换模块,发送端和接收端通过无线方式通讯连接,MCU模块分别与扫频信号发生器模块、超声波驱动模块、以及第一Lora模块电连接,扫频信号发生器模块还通过超声波驱动模块与第一超声波换能器电连接,数字信号处理模块与通讯模块、第二Lora模块、存储模块、以及模数转换模块电连接,第二超声波换能器通过超声波信号调节模块与模数转换模块电连接,其特征在于,所述工作方法包括以下步骤:
(1)数字信号处理模块自主唤醒,并控制第二Lora模块向第一Lora模块点对点发送唤醒数据包;
(2)第一Lora模块在接收到来自第二Lora模块的唤醒数据包后唤醒MCU模块,并等待接收来自第二Lora模块的数据包;
(3)数字信号处理模块控制第二Lora模块向第一Lora模块发送数据包,并设置计数器i=1,该数据包中包括工作频率F和发送功率P;
(4)第一Lora模块将来自第二Lora模块的数据包传送到MCU模块;
(5)MCU模块对来自第一Lora模块的数据包进行解析,以获得该数据包中的工作频率F和发送功率P,控制扫频信号发生器模块产生工作频率为F的正弦信号,并控制超声波驱动模块驱动第一超声波换能器以工作功率P将产生的正弦信号发送到第二超声波换能器;
(6)第二超声波换能器通过超声波信号调节模块将来自于第一超声波换能器的正弦信号传输到模数转换模块;
(7)数字信号处理模块控制模数转换模块对来自第二超声波换能器的正弦信号进行单次采样,并获取单次采样得到的多个数字信号;
(8)数字信号处理模块判断步骤(7)得到的多个数字信号中任意三个连续的数字信号中每一个的振幅是否等于模数转换模块量程的最大值,如果是则进入步骤(22),否则进入步骤(9);
(9)数字信号处理模块将第一超声波换能器的工作功率P和工作频率F存储在存储模块中,并设置变量Pi=P;
(10)数字信号处理模块控制第二Lora模块向第一Lora模块发送数据包,该数据包中包括变更后的频率Fi=F0+(i-1)b,变更后的功率P=P0;
(11)数字信号处理模块判断是否有i小于常数imax成立,如果是则设置i=i+1,并返回步骤(4),否则进入步骤(12);其中imax的取值等于2/b+1;
(12)数字信号处理模块从P1、P2、…、Pi中获取最小值Pm、以及此时的频率Fm,并设置计数器j=1,其中m∈[1,i];
(13)数字信号处理模块控制第二Lora模块以时间间隔T(其中30sT2s)向第一Lora模块发送数据包,该数据包中包括变更后的频率F=Fm,变更后的功率P=Pm;
(14)第一Lora模块将来自第二Lora模块的数据包传送到MCU模块;
(15)MCU模块对来自第一Lora模块的数据包进行解析,以获得该数据包中的变更后的频率F和变更后的功率P,控制扫频信号发生器模块产生工作频率为F的正弦脉冲信号,并控制超声波驱动模块驱动第一超声波换能器以工作功率P将产生的正弦脉冲信号发送到第二超声波换能器;
(16)第二超声波换能器通过超声波信号调节模块将来自于第一超声波换能器的正弦信号传输到模数转换模块;
(17)数字信号处理模块控制模数转换模块对来自第二超声波换能器的正弦信号进行第j次采样,并获取第j次采样得到的多个数字信号,并对每个数字信号进行傅里叶变换,以得到傅里叶变换结果中1到10倍频的系数,并对第j次采样得到的所有傅里叶变换结果中等于频率F的1到10倍频的系数和第j-1次采样得到的数字信号的傅里叶变换结果中等于频率F的1到10倍频的系数进行相关运算,以得到运算结果R;
(18)数字信号处理模块判断相关运算结果R是否小于预设阈值R0,如果是则进入步骤(19),否则设置j=j+1,并返回步骤(13);
(19)数字信号处理模块设置报警持续时间Tc,控制第二Lora模块以广播方式持续发送报警信号,并控制通讯模块向后台持续发送报警信号;
(20)数字信号处理模块判断通讯模块或者第二Lora模块是否接收到工作结束指令,如果是则过程结束,否则进入步骤(21);
(21)数字信号处理模块判断报警持续时间Tc是否已经到达,如果是则返回步骤(13),否则返回步骤(19);
(22)数字信号处理模块控制第二Lora模块向第一Lora模块发送数据包,该数据包中包括变更后的功率P=P-a,并返回步骤(4),其中a为预设常数。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于西南交通大学;中科(湖南)先进轨道交通研究院有限公司,未经西南交通大学;中科(湖南)先进轨道交通研究院有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110155550.0/1.html,转载请声明来源钻瓜专利网。